About this route:
A direct, nonstop flight between Luke Air Force BaseLuke Field (LUF), Glendale, Arizona, United States and Morombe Airport (MXM), Morombe, Madagascar would travel a Great Circle distance of 10,751 miles (or 17,302 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Luke Air Force BaseLuke Field and Morombe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Luke Air Force BaseLuke Field (LUF):
- Ground school, or classroom training for the advanced flying course, varied from about 100 to 130 hours and was intermingled with flight time in the aircraft.
- The base was under the control of the 37th Flying Training Wing, Western Flying Training Command, AAF Flying Training Command.
- Luke Air Force Base is a United States Air Force base located seven miles west of the central business district of Glendale, in Maricopa County, Arizona, United States.
- On 25 May 1953 the 3600th Air Demonstration Team was officially organized and established at Luke, still officially carrying this designation, now known as the United States Air Force Thunderbirds.

- Because of Morombe Airport's relatively low elevation of 0 feet, planes can take off or land at Morombe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
